ChemInform Abstract

The reactivities of the silicon-allyl bonds in the penta-coordinated silicon compounds (I) and (II) are compared. The allyl transfer to the carbonyl compounds (III), yielding the homoallylic alcohols (IV), requires nucleophilic conditions in the case of (I), while (II) reacts similarly under electrophilic conditions. (IIIc) and (II) form 1-allylcyclohexene (V) as the main product due to dehydration of the alcohol (IVc).
